August 15 - Knoxville, TN
First off, I want to say that Knoxville is off the chain:-) You guys are in a different groove. And I mean that in a good way. We played tonight at a great old venue. It was wonderful. Having said all of that, let me tell you that tonight was one of those nights that I would not want to wish on a snake. What ever could go wrong went wrong for me. The monitor system went bad at the start of one song, and then at the start of the second half of the show my cord was not plugged into the bass. I was having a day from hell. But, even with all of the problems the show was great. This crowd had a great vibe to it from the top. We were allowed to take a lot of adventures and the audience really came along. There were people giving us standing ovations almost after every song. I've never seen that before.
Tonight was special. I kind of figured that the audience would be good but, they surpassed my expectations by a mile. We had a day off and I walked around the city a little. What I found was a city with a lot of different musics going on all over. A perfect place for a band like the Noisemakers.
We love to stretch the limits of our music and the good people of Knoxville streched right along with us. It was also great to see that Si made it across the pond.
Tonight Bruce sung his ass off on Fields Of Gray. And Sonny played an amazing drum solo in the middle of Spider Fingers (even by his standards).
